Fanatics Casino Launches Seven-Level Fanatics ONE Rewards Programme in Pennsylvania

The casino loyalty scheme adds FanCash multipliers, casino credit offers and weekly promotions across four states.

Fanatics Casino has launched Fanatics ONE Casino Rewards, a seven-level loyalty programme now live in the Fanatics Sports and Casino app, including for players in Pennsylvania. The programme is also available in Michigan, New Jersey and West Virginia.

Players unlock better benefits as they progress through the levels. The offers include FanCash multipliers, Casino Credit offers, Mystery Drops, weekly Bet & Get FanCash promotions and entries to weekly sweepstakes, according to Fanatics Casino.

FanCash can be redeemed for Casino Credit, bonus bets and exclusive Fanatics apparel, among other rewards. The casino-specific scheme arrives under the Fanatics ONE name, an enterprise-wide loyalty programme spanning apparel, collectibles, betting, casino rewards and events.

The two programmes use different tier structures. Fanatics ONE has five member tiers, while the new casino rewards programme has seven levels. The entry-level enterprise tier, ONEmember, offers 5% FanCash back on purchases through the Fanatics App and up to 10% on Fanatics Sportsbook bets, whether they win or lose.

The launch is being marketed through a Taraji P. Henson-led campaign, “The House Always Rewards.” Henson plays Fran, an anti-hero who is frustrated by how often customers receive rewards. Fanatics Casino said the campaign reverses the familiar casino proposition that “the house always wins,” instead presenting its house as one that rewards players.

Michael Afflick, Fanatics Casino’s vice-president of marketing, said the campaign also features Louis, Kameron, Kaitlyn and Austen, who repeatedly raise the rewards programme in Fran’s presence. The broader “House Always Rewards” platform first debuted March 18 with 30- and 15-second broadcast advertisements and a 90-second digital film.

As we reported Sept. 2, Fanatics had already rolled out its unified Fanatics Sports & Casino app, bringing its gaming products under one login and a single FanCash balance. Fanatics Casino and Sportsbook first launched in Pennsylvania in January 2024, when casino customers could earn FanCash on bets, spins and hands.
